Claims (8)
- 자기매체 상에 기록될 데이터 신호의 기록을 예비보상하며, 입력 데이터 신호를 받아들이는 입력과 기록될 출력 데이터 신호를 공급하는 출력을 구비하고, 이들 출력 데이터 신호 내부의 신호 천이의 적어도 일부가 상기 입력 데이터 신호 내부의 이에 대응하는 신호 천이에 대해 지연되는 기록 예비보상 장치에 있어서,입력 데이터 신호를 수신하여, 이 데이터 신호에 동기되고 그것의 진폭이 시간의 함수로서 직선적으로 변화하며 그 진폭이 한 개의 데이터 심볼 간격으로 제한되는 출력 신호를 공급하는 적분기/리미터 회로와, 상기 입력 신호를 수신하여, 그것의 순시값이 데이터 신호 내부의 선행하는 신호 천이 또는 장래의 신호 천이 패턴에 의존하는 출력 신호를 공급하는 가변 필터와, 상기 적분기/리미터 회로의 출력 신호와 상기 필터의 출력 신호를 비교하여, 상기 입력 데이터 신호의 적어도 일부분의 신호 천이가 시간 측으로 이동된 출력 신호를 발생하는 비교기 회로를 구비한 것을 특징으로 하는 기록 예비보상 장치.
- 제 1 항에 있어서,상기 적분기/리미터 회로의 신호 경로는 상기 입력 데이터 신호를 최소한 한개의 데이터 심볼 간격 만큼 지연시키는 수단을 구비한 것을 특징으로 하는 기록예비보상 장치 .
- 제 1 항에 있어서,상기 필터는, 소정 개수의 비트 값이 가변 가중인자와 곱해져 그 승산 결과값이 가산됨으로써 필터의 출력신호가 얻어지는 트랜스버설 필터를 구비한 것을 특징으로 하는 기록 예비보상 장치.
- 제 2 항에 있어서,상기 데이터 신호 내부의 심볼 bk로부터 심볼 bk+1로의 신호천이에 있어서의 타임 시프트를 결정하기 위해, 복수의 심볼 bk+1, bk-1 및 bk-2[단, bk+j = ε(+l, -1)이다]가 사용되는 것을 특징으로 하는 기록 예비보상 장치.
- 제 2 항에 있어서,상기 필터는 테이블 필터를 구비한 것을 특징으로 하는 기록 예비보상 장치.
- 제 2 항에 있어서,상기 필터는 RAM필터를 구비한 것을 특징으로 하는 기록 예비보상 장치.
- 제 2 항에 있어서,상기 필터는 아날로그 필터를 구비한 것을 특징으로 하는 기록 예비보상 장치.
- 제 2 항에 있어서,상기 필터는, 소정 개수의 비트 값이 가변 가중인자와 곱해져 그 승산 결과값이 가산됨으로써 필터의 출력신호가 얻어지는 트랜스버설 필터를 구비한 것을 특징으로 하는 기록 예비보상 장치.
